AccelMap.lockPath

Locks the given accelerator path. If the accelerator map doesn’t yet contain an entry for accel_path, a new one is created.

Locking an accelerator path prevents its accelerator from being changed during runtime. A locked accelerator path can be unlocked by gtk.accel_map.AccelMap.unlockPath. Refer to gtk.accel_map.AccelMap.changeEntry for information about runtime accelerator changes.

If called more than once, accel_path remains locked until gtk.accel_map.AccelMap.unlockPath has been called an equivalent number of times.

Note that locking of individual accelerator paths is independent from locking the #GtkAccelGroup containing them. For runtime accelerator changes to be possible, both the accelerator path and its #GtkAccelGroup have to be unlocked.

class AccelMap
static
void
lockPath
(
string accelPath
)

Parameters

accelPath string

a valid accelerator path